Microsoft has released apps for News,
Finance, Weather, and Sports on
Windows Phone 8.
The apps can be downloaded free of
charge through the Windows Phone
Store. Microsoft has detailed the apps
in a blog post.
The Bing News app features headlines
and videos of breaking news and is
customisable, allowing users to track
specific story categories, topics, or
news sources. It also allows users to
rearrange headline clusters to keep
news that's relevant to them at the
top.
Microsoft has partnered with editorial
and news agencies including Associated
Press, Reuters, Gizmodo, and The
Guardian, among others, in addition to
other local and regional sources. In
India, the app features NDTV, India
Today, IBN Live and Reuters for local
news. The app also supports Live Tiles
and users can also pin a favourite news
source or a personal topic to their
Start screen for quick access.
The Bing Sports app offers recent
scores, top sports headlines, videos,
photos, schedules, standings, statistics
and other content across most major
sports, including soccer, football,
baseball, cricket, racing, tennis, hockey,
and basketball.
The Bing Weather app offers up-to-
date current conditions including
temperature, precipitation and
wind.The app also dynamically updates
the live tile based upon the user's
current location. They can also save
other locations to get the weather.
The app offers weather with dynamic
maps for cities or regions in a number
of categories including satellite,
temperature, precipitation, cloud cover
and radar. Users can also check daily
weather conditions, historical data and
view charts for temperature and
precipitation through the app.
The Bing Finance app offers financial
news, market info, currency
conversions, stock updates for the US
and customisable interactive charts.
Users can set up a watchlist to track
their stocks and pin individual stocks to
their phone's Start screen for live tile
updates. Users can also track
performance of a stock, browse news
about the company, stock statistics
and an overview of the company. The
financial info is provided through tie-
ups with Bloomberg, CNBC, and Fox
Business.
Microsoft had also launched similar
apps on Windows 8 in October 2012.
